Is there a lot of diversity? Are people in Minturno accepting of differences?

Answer this Question

When we asked people about diversity in Minturno and whether locals are accepting of differences, they said...

"Minturno is a diverse city with a population of over 20,000 people. The city is home to a variety of cultures, including Italian, Albanian, and Romanian. People in Minturno are generally accepting of differences and embrace the diversity of their city. The city is known for its vibrant cultural events and festivals, which celebrate the diversity of its population," commented one expat who made the move to Minturno, Italy.
